This template implements a for loop or a foreach loop. This template calls a user-specified template (the "called template") multiple times: once for each value in either 1) an iterated sequence or 2) an explicit list. Each value in the sequence or list is passed to the same specified parameter of the called template (the "variable parameter").

In computer programming, foreach loop (or for-each loop) is a control flow statement for traversing items in a collection. foreach is usually used in place of a standard for loop statement . Unlike other for loop constructs, however, foreach loops [ 1 ] usually maintain no explicit counter: they essentially say "do this to everything in this ...
